- Rangifer
Byng Pass:- Aug [August] 26/43 [1943]
Census [underlined] From camp saw
2 old [female symbol], 1 large calf.
1 juv [juvenile] [male symbol], 1 [female symbol]
6 other caribou apparently [female symbol]'s or young [male symbol]'s.
Behavior:- The most restless animals I have ever
seen. Eat a few bites + move a few yards
+ all movement is at the trot. Shy at
all sorts of objects like a scary horse
Just now many of them are spending
much of the day on the high shale ridges
where the high wind keeps the flies off.
Continual tail twitching + stomping of the
hind feet when feeding in daytime suggests
fly attack other than bots. But Bot
attack is taking place also + frequently
stampedes them.
We notice that when caribou
cross a shale slide they do so as individuals
+ each is likely to take its own course
As a result instead of 4 or 5 good
trails as sheep or goat would have there
may be as high as 40 or 50 separate
tracks.
" [Byng Pass] Aug. [August] 27/43 [1943]
Census:- 2 [female symbol] + calf (probably same as yesterday)
1 [female symbol]
1 juv [juvenile] sex?
1 yng [young] (2 yrs [years] [+/-]) [female symbol]
Licks:- 3 licks nearby 2 dark earth one paler earth
the latter seems to have a spring as its centre
